Japan’s far-right Sanseito party, now top opposition force, launches global unit to link with Trump allies and boost influence.
Japan’s far-right Sanseito party, which won 15 seats in July’s upper house election and is now the top opposition force in polls, has launched an international division to forge ties with Trump allies like Steve Bannon and conservative figures in Europe.
Led by Sohei Kamiya, the party aims to boost its global credibility amid domestic media bias and rising public frustration over living costs, using anti-immigration rhetoric and conspiracy theories to gain support.
With the ruling LDP losing its majority, Sanseito seeks 30–40 seats in the next lower-house election, positioning itself as a major political challenger through international conservative alliances.
